## Authentication

Heads up: the nightly reindex job (`reindex_nightly.py`) talks to the Lanternfish search cluster, and that cluster won't accept anonymous writes anymore — we locked it down last sprint. The job now authenticates as the `reindex-runner` service identity against Corvid Gateway, and the token is injected via the `LF_INDEX_TOKEN` env var in the scheduler config. Nothing clever going on, just a bearer header on every batch request. For review purposes, the staging credential currently in use is listed below.

service key, kadug-kadup: kto15_rN23XLAYImmZgrJ

Handover note — Crumbwheel order cutoffs.

Welcome aboard. The bakery cutoff rule in Crumbwheel closes same-day orders at 14:00 local to each storefront, not UTC — this has bitten us twice. Holiday overrides live in the calendar service and take precedence silently, so always check there first when a cutoff looks wrong. To unlock the calendar service's admin console after a restart, enter the recovery passphrase below.

vault phrase of bagap-bahaf = silion-pelox-sorox-casdor-quenwyn-fraax-eliox-praael-kelion-quenvan-kasox-rusael-norius-belvan

Step 7: Rebalance the Hollowbrook profile store across the new shard ring. Welcome aboard — this step is safe but slow, so schedule it during low traffic. Verify shard map version 12 is active on every node, then drain the old ring gradually. The migration tool refuses to start without a signed manifest, so sign it with the deploy key shown below.

deploy key for kajof-fajop: bky6_gDHw9Q